Rodriguez" Subject: [PATCH 02/18] mac80211: drop frames for sta with no valid rate Date: Wed, 10 Jun 2009 04:19:19 -0400 Message-Id: <1244621975-1238-3-git-send-email-lrodriguez@atheros.com> In-Reply-To: <1244621975-1238-1-git-send-email-lrodriguez@atheros.com> References: <1244621975-1238-1-git-send-email-lrodriguez@atheros.com> Sender: linux-wireless-owner@vger.kernel.org List-ID: When we're associated we should be able to send data to target sta. If we cannot we may be trying to use the incorrect band to talk to the sta. Lets catch any such cases, warn, and drop the frames to not invalidate assumptions being made on rate control algorithms when they have a valid sta to communicate with. Any such cases should be handled and fixed. Signed-off-by: Luis R.
